Transaction 63f93457c11841591a00997c2cc0843fb05e25d2a8cd201ca1acbf7d00b77f9a
1 Input
1 Output
-
63f93457c11841591a00997c2cc0843fb05e25d2a8cd201ca1acbf7d00b77f9a:0
- value
- 154438632
- script pubkey
- OP_0 OP_PUSHBYTES_20 77167e59c9724e8335d5aa90597f060bd82db673
- address
- ltc1qwut8ukwfwf8gxdw442g9jlcxp0vzmdnn6ulaxt